摘要
1,4-Diiodo-1,3-dienes are unique reagents in organic synthesis and have been employed in several well-known and recently developed areas of application. Furthermore, these dienes are easily accessible, starting from the alkynes and iodine, and they have demonstrated high reactivity in cross-coupling reactions, organometallic synthesis, in the preparation of heterocyclic compounds, and several other transformations. The high reactivity of the 1,4-diiodo-1,3-dienes allows for the development of synthetic procedures that use mild conditions (room temperature). The key advantages in assembling complex organic molecules, natural products, and compounds for material science using 1,4-diiodo-1,3-dienes as building blocks include high yields, excellent selectivity, and diverse reactivity in carbon-carbon and carbon-heteroatom bond formation. This Focus Review describes the scope and application of the 1,4-diiodo-1,3-dienes in organic synthesis as well as summarizes the methods for preparation of the dienes.
